Automation in Agriculture
Automation is becoming a dominant trend, helping to reduce strenuous manual labor and increase production efficiency. Automated machinery such as planting machines, harvesting machines, and drones are widely used to optimize the cultivation process, from land preparation to harvesting and transportation.
Big Data and Artificial Intelligence in Agriculture
The collection and analysis of Big Data combined with Artificial Intelligence (AI) are creating breakthroughs in agriculture. Sensors and IoT devices are used to monitor soil conditions, crops, and weather, helping farmers make accurate and timely decisions, optimizing the use of water, fertilizers, and pesticides.
Precision Farming
Precision farming is an efficient resource management method that allows farmers to adjust inputs such as water, fertilizer, and pesticides precisely based on the specific needs of each area in the field. This helps minimize waste and protect the environment.
Challenges and Opportunities
Although agricultural technology offers many benefits, its application faces some challenges such as high investment costs, a shortage of skilled labor, and disparities in access to technology between regions. However, the opportunities that technology offers are enormous, helping to improve productivity, product quality, reduce production costs, and protect the environment.
